如何跟踪PHP代码
在软件开发的过程中,跟踪代码是一个至关重要的步骤,特别是在调试和排除错误时。对于PHP开发人员来说,了解如何有效地跟踪PHP代码是至关重要的。本文将介绍几种常用的方法和工具,帮助你更好地理解和定位PHP代码中的问题。
使用PHP调试器
一种常见的方法是使用PHP调试器来跟踪代码。PHP调试器是一种工具,可以帮助开发人员在代码中设置断点,并逐步执行代码以查看变量的值和执行流程。通过调试器,开发人员可以更轻松地定位和解决代码中的问题。
有几种流行的PHP调试器可供选择,如Xdebug和Zend Debugger。这些调试器通常与IDE集成,提供了强大的调试功能,帮助开发人员快速定位问题。
使用日志记录
除了调试器之外,另一种常见的跟踪PHP代码的方法是通过日志记录。开发人员可以在代码中插入日志语句,记录关键变量的值以及代码执行的路径。通过查看这些日志,开发人员可以了解代码的执行情况,并找出问题所在。
在PHP中,可以使用内置的日志函数如error_log或者使用第三方的日志库如Monolog来记录日志信息。通过适当的日志记录,开发人员可以更好地理解代码的执行流程。
代码审查
代码审查是另一种帮助跟踪PHP代码的方法。通过定期进行代码审查,团队可以相互学习和改进代码质量。在代码审查过程中,团队成员可以分享最佳实践、发现潜在问题并提出改进建议。
代码审查不仅可以帮助发现代码中的错误,还可以加强团队协作,并提高整体代码质量。通过定期的代码审查,团队可以共同进步,避免将潜在的问题带入生产环境。
使用单元测试
单元测试是一种重要的跟踪PHP代码的方法。通过编写单元测试用例,开发人员可以验证代码的各个部分是否按预期工作。单元测试可以帮助开发人员快速发现代码中的问题,并确保代码的稳定性。
在PHP中,可以使用PHPUnit等测试框架来编写和运行单元测试。通过编写全面的单元测试用例,开发人员可以更自信地修改和重构代码,同时防止引入新的问题。
使用性能分析工具
除了调试和日志记录之外,使用性能分析工具也是跟踪PHP代码的一种重要方法。性能分析工具可以帮助开发人员了解代码的执行性能,并找出潜在的性能瓶颈。
在PHP开发中,常用的性能分析工具包括Blackfire和XHProf等。这些工具可以生成详细的性能报告,帮助开发人员优化代码并提高性能。
结语
跟踪PHP代码是每个PHP开发人员都应该掌握的重要技能。通过使用调试器、日志记录、代码审查、单元测试和性能分析工具,开发人员可以更好地理解和优化代码,提高开发效率和代码质量。
希望本文介绍的方法和工具能够帮助你更好地跟踪和调试PHP代码,提升开发技能和效率。
- 相关评论
- 我要评论
-